VR Graffiti Game Kingspray Hits Quest This Week

VR Graffiti Game Kingspray Hits Quest This Week

Remember Kingspray? It was a great little VR graffiti experience that launched alongside PC VR headsets. We’d all but forgotten about it, but it turns out Kingspray Quest is coming soon.

Kingspray’s developers just confirmed that the game will hit the standalone VR headset on October 17th (thanks to Polish Paul for pointing this one out to us!). The news was accompanied by a new trailer for the game. We’re especially big fans of the bit where someone stands in front of a wall wearing a Quest.

Kingspray gives you all of the tools to create virtual wall art on the fly. You’re able to quickly change colors, scale walls to reach other areas and undo any mistakes. Judging by the trailer, multiplayer support will be included. No word on if there will be cross-buy support with the Oculus Rift version, though.

Kingspray Graffiti takes a simple premise and expands it out to the point that it offers all of the features you’d ever want — and plenty that you probably didn’t know you wanted,” we said in our review of the app all the way back in 2016. “It feels like the real thing, but it also lets you do so much more than what the typical artist could ever do in real life.”

We’ll admit we’re a little surprised to see the game making the jump to Quest. Its Twitter account has been silent for years and its Facebook page made its first post in 16 months in early September. We’d assumed the game was all but lost to time, but hopefully it can find a new lease of life on Quest. Still no word on a PSVR release, though.
